About this subject
Blue ice caves form inside glaciers when meltwater carves tunnels and chambers into the ice. The ancient ice, compressed over centuries, has lost most of its air bubbles, allowing light to penetrate and refract, resulting in the intense blue hue. These caves are primarily found in Vatnajökull, Europe's largest glacier, as well as in Langjökull and Mýrdalsjökull. Every winter, new caves are created and old ones may collapse, making each visit a unique experience.
The visiting season runs from November to March, when temperatures are low enough to keep the structures stable. Guided tours ensure safety and access to remote locations. Inside, the caves offer a natural light show, with colors ranging from deep blue to turquoise, depending on ice thickness and sunlight angle. Late afternoon light often produces the most dramatic effects.
Beyond tourism, these caves are important for scientific research. Scientists analyze ice layers to reconstruct past climates and monitor climate change impacts. The accelerated melting of Icelandic glaciers has altered cave formation dynamics, making them more unpredictable. Responsible tourism helps fund the preservation of these fragile environments.
Interestingly, Iceland has many legends about trolls and magical beings inhabiting ice caves. In Norse mythology, ice and fire are the world's creating elements, and these caves represent a link between primordial forces. Today, combining adventure and science, they attract travelers from around the world seeking otherworldly landscapes.
Frequently Asked Questions
What is the best time to visit ice caves in Iceland?
The best time is from November to March, during winter, when temperatures are low and the caves are more stable. Guided tours are essential for safety.
Are ice caves safe to visit?
Yes, when visited with experienced guides who monitor ice conditions. Natural caves can collapse, so it is prohibited to go without professional accompaniment.
Why is the ice in the caves blue?
Ancient ice is extremely dense and compressed, with few air bubbles. White sunlight penetrates, red wavelengths are absorbed, and blue wavelengths are reflected, creating the intense blue color.
